CVE-2024-44033 is a Stored Cross-site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ability found in the NicheAddons Primary Addon for Elementor, affecting versions up to and including 1.5.7. This medium-severity vulnerability (CVSS 5.4) allows an attacker with low privileges to inject malicious scripts, which could lead to limited impact on confidentiality and integrity if a user interacts with the crafted content. There is currently no evidence of active exploitation, nor are there public exploit modules available in Metasploit or Nuclei, and it has received minimal community discussion or media coverage.
